One glaring Kapernick flaw


CRA

Recommended Posts

Lots of broken plays/lack of playbook knowledge(considering how long he has been there)

- against GB, for example, the burned timeout to open up the 2nd half? Dumb announcers missed why. Kapernick took the field without his cheat sheet wrist band and pooped his pants. THAT is why he called the timeout. He didn't have his wrist band with his plays.

- again, for example against GB, there were a couple handoffs he turns the wrong way and kills the play. He takes off so fast and actually can turn them into positive plays they often go unnoticed.

Point? With these rare dummy mishaps occur Carolina needs to capitalize on them. He is a streaky player like Cam. Can't let him turn a goof into a positive play.

and double Crabtree. He is a first read and throw QB for the most part still and that is where he wants to go heavily.
